Nirmohi Akhara Issues Press Release Highlighting Spiritual, Social, and Environmental Initiatives

In a recent press briefing held at the main headquarters of Nirmohi Akhara, senior saints and spokespersons presented an official press release summarizing the Akhara’s ongoing initiatives, recent achievements, and future plans. This announcement reaffirms the Akhara’s multidimensional role in preserving Sanatan Dharma, serving society, and promoting spiritual and ecological harmony.

Founded centuries ago and rooted in the principles of Bhakti, Seva, and Shastra, Nirmohi Akhara continues to be a guiding force not only for spiritual aspirants but also for the larger national and cultural consciousness of Bharat.


Highlights from the Press Release

  1. Spiritual Engagement and Teachings
    The Akhara emphasized its ongoing Vedic teachings, daily discourses, and scriptural seminars across various ashrams. Senior acharyas are conducting online and in-person classes to help the younger generation reconnect with spiritual values, Sanskrit learning, and the essence of Vaishnav traditions.
  2. Social Welfare Campaigns
    • Annadan Seva: More than 50,000 people have benefited from monthly food distribution drives across 8 states.
    • Disaster Relief: The Akhara provided emergency supplies and shelter to flood-affected families in Uttarakhand and Bihar.
    • Healthcare Camps: Ayurvedic wellness camps and medical aid drives have been organized in rural and tribal areas.
  3. Environmental & River Conservation
    Recognizing the spiritual and ecological importance of sacred rivers like the Ganga and Sarayu, Nirmohi Akhara is conducting Ghat-cleaning drives, tree plantation events, and awareness yatras. These campaigns are aligned with national missions like Namami Gange and support Sanatan principles of nature worship.
  4. Upcoming Events
    • Participation in the next Kumbh Mela is being planned with a focus on eco-conscious pilgrimage.
    • Annual Dharm Sansad is scheduled, where leading saints from across Bharat will discuss national and spiritual issues.
    • A series of youth spiritual leadership camps will be launched to groom the next generation of dharmic ambassadors.
